Dublin had the tenth highest levels of ketamine in municipal wastewater of all cities tested in Europe, pointing to a possible increasing use of the psychoactive dissociative anesthetic drug.
The Irish capital also had the 15th highest reading for ketamine in wastewater of the cities tested worldwide in 2024 with a daily average of 43.5mg, according to a new European Union Drugs Agency (EUDA) study.
